Usage() {
    echo ""
    echo "Usage: tbss_fill <stats_image> <threshold> <mean_FA> <output> [-n]"
    echo "  -n : include negative stat values (below -threshold)"
    echo ""
    exit 1
}

do_tbss_fill() {
    IN=$1
    OUT=$2

    # threshold the input then convolve with sphere of radius 3mm
    $FSLDIR/bin/fslmaths $IN -thr $THRESH -kernel sphere 3 -fmean $OUT -odt float

    # renorm so that the max is same as input's max
    $FSLDIR/bin/fslmaths $OUT -div `${FSLDIR}/bin/fslstats $OUT -p 100` -mul `${FSLDIR}/bin/fslstats $IN -p 100` $OUT

    # average with thresholded input (to enhance appearance of skeleton within final output)
    # then multiply by mean-FA (to ensure we stay within real tracts)
    $FSLDIR/bin/fslmaths $IN -thr $THRESH -add $OUT -div 2 -mul $MEANFA -div `${FSLDIR}/bin/fslstats $MEANFA -p 100` $OUT -odt float

    # final thresholding at 1/50 of max value
    $FSLDIR/bin/fslmaths $OUT -thr `${FSLDIR}/bin/fslstats $OUT -R | awk '{print "10 k " $2 " 50 / p"}' | dc -` $OUT
}

[ "$4" = "" ] && Usage

STATS=$1
THRESH=$2
MEANFA=$3
OUTPUT=$4

if [ `${FSLDIR}/bin/imtest $STATS` = 0 ] || [ `${FSLDIR}/bin/imtest $MEANFA` = 0 ] ; then
    echo "Error - either <stats_image> or <mean_FA> is not valid"
    Usage
fi

do_tbss_fill $STATS $OUTPUT

if [ "$5" != "" ] ; then
    $FSLDIR/bin/fslmaths $STATS -mul -1 ${OUTPUT}neg
    do_tbss_fill ${OUTPUT}neg ${OUTPUT}negout
    $FSLDIR/bin/fslmaths $OUTPUT -sub ${OUTPUT}negout $OUTPUT
    /bin/rm ${OUTPUT}neg*
fi
